SP Cai, CA Chang, JZ Zhang, RK Saiki, HA Erlich and YW Kan
Department of Medicine, University of California, San Francisco 94143-
0724.
We used in vitro DNA amplification by the polymerase chain reaction and
nonradioactive probes for prenatal diagnosis of beta thalassemia in Chinese
from the Guangdong province. Exact molecular diagnoses were made in all 20
fetuses studied over a 6-month period. We conclude that this method of
prenatal diagnosis for beta thalassemia is a viable approach in many parts
of the world where this disease is common.
